Thalia For Science In Nigeria
Her name is simply Thalia! Does that sound unfamiliar? A science foundation in an old city Volunteering to tackle The Gritty, Here in Nigeria accomplish What her compatriots wish; Like fingers not failed by triggers The firm shovels of firm diggers, Already reinforcing The Walls of Science And up bracing Arochukwu’s commonsense; The little left of her research courage Long lost and becoming an adage … Because, personally, I’d seen it all Set rolling like A League’s Ball: The many computers in the rooms they belong, A skeleton I hope shall sing a song, A Nutrition Lab promising superb cookery And gas-cookers pledging no trickery; Thalia’s control room for fishing prowlers out, Sixteen screens for crooks to think about. Arochukwu THALIA puts at an advantage And her lips readies for vintage; On the whole, a reason to love The White Man And stop being astonished each time he can.
